If you are looking for a rugged laptop that can run Windows XP, you might be interested in the Panasonic CF29 Toughbook. This laptop was designed for military and industrial use, and it can withstand harsh environments and rough handling. It has a magnesium alloy case, a shock-mounted hard drive, a sealed keyboard and touchpad, and a sunlight-readable touchscreen display. It also has a long battery life, a built-in handle, and various ports and slots for connectivity.
